Size & Fit
| Size | Dimensions | Approx. Capacity | Weight | Suggested Use |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Small | 140 x 140 x 130 mm | Water about 200 ml / Food about 95 g | About 1.1 kg | Cats, small dogs, small daily portions. |
| Large | 172 x 172 x 174 mm | Water about 380 ml / Food about 195 g | About 1.8 kg | Larger portions or pets who need more bowl space. |
Tilted bowls may hold less liquid than flat bowls of the same width. When using Signac for water, fill conservatively and place it on a flat, stable surface.
What to Expect
- Hand-blown glass may have slight variation in texture, weight, and reflection.
- The bowl is heavy for its size, but no bowl is fully tip-proof for pets that push aggressively.
- The tilted opening may be better for feeding than for filling to the top with water.
- Glass products need careful handling and protected shipping.
- Not intended for large dogs, rough play, or pets that throw or push bowls.

FAQ
Can Signac be used for water?
Yes, but fill conservatively. Tilted bowls hold liquid differently than flat bowls, so do not fill it to the rim.
Will the tilted shape spill food?
When placed on a flat surface and filled appropriately, the tilted opening is designed for daily feeding. Overfilling may cause spills.
Is every Signac bowl exactly the same?
No. Because Signac is hand-blown glass, subtle variation in texture, weight, and light reflection may occur.
Is it suitable for dogs?
Signac is best for cats and small dogs with gentle feeding habits. It is not recommended for large dogs or pets that push bowls aggressively.
How should I clean it?
Use mild dish soap and a soft sponge. Avoid sudden temperature changes and stop using the bowl if it becomes cracked or chipped.
